Transaction c36c5477c9f5917fa04561f81a137109c74b35739e4acb7e9428f269e68dc80d

7 Input
2 Outputs
  • c36c5477c9f5917fa04561f81a137109c74b35739e4acb7e9428f269e68dc80d:0
  • value  14524296
    address  1ApuXBgxTYUSXGoyL4TCcxMSwvyK3y7wsg
  • c36c5477c9f5917fa04561f81a137109c74b35739e4acb7e9428f269e68dc80d:1
  • value  805937
    address  14dpiBPrNyDUiEiYVxTo1ph8nHSFLmH9cs